Portfolio Analysis
A systematic process of evaluating the elements of a portfolio, assessing their performance, risk, and interrelations, to inform strategic decisions and optimize returns.
Spend Map
A visual representation that depicts an organization's expenditure across different departments, suppliers, or categories, often used to identify cost-saving opportunities.
Multiple Sourcing
The strategy of procuring a particular product or service from more than one supplier in order to reduce dependency on any single source and increase reliability and competitiveness.
Bottleneck Items
Items or stages in a process that significantly delay production or throughput due to their limited capacity or efficiency.
